In modern medicine, the line between an animal's physical health and its psychological state has nearly disappeared. Today, veterinarians recognize that behavior is often the first "diagnostic" tool available. Whether it’s a cat hiding because of subtle kidney pain or a dog showing aggression due to an undiagnosed neurological issue, understanding behavior is essential for providing effective care.
